About Anona

Anona’s quiet streets and easy local access.

Anona is a quiet residential pocket in Largo, tucked near Indian Rocks Road and the routes leading toward Belleair and the Intracoastal. Stay here for easy access to neighborhood diners, local errands, and bus connections, with central Largo and nearby waterfront stretches close by for simple, practical stays.

Plan for driving and easy parking

Anona in Largo works best with a car, especially if you are heading to errands, parks, or dining beyond the neighborhood. Choose a stay with on-site parking, since street spaces can be limited and convenience matters after dark.

Quiet windows make a difference

Even in a calm residential area like Anona, traffic, lawn work, and nearby activity can carry. If you are a light sleeper, look for solid windows and a unit set back from main roads for a more restful stay.

Match the stay to your plans

Anona suits travelers who want a low-key base in Largo more than a nightlife scene. Families and longer stays usually benefit from this quieter setting, while guests relying on late-night walkability may want to stay closer to busier areas.

Is Anona in Largo, Florida, a walkable neighborhood for a stay?

Anona is more residential than pedestrian-focused, so you may find it easy to walk short distances within quieter streets, but it is not the kind of neighborhood where most errands, dining, or attractions are all within one walk. If walkability matters, check your property listing for nearby sidewalks and local access points.

02 / 05
Do you need a car when staying in Anona, Largo?

A car is often the most convenient way to stay in Anona, especially if you plan to explore beaches, grocery stores, and surrounding parts of Largo and Pinellas County. Public transit and ride-hailing can help with some trips, but a vehicle usually gives you the most flexibility for this area.

03 / 05
What is the atmosphere like in Anona, Largo for travelers?

Anona has a calm, neighborhood feel that suits travelers looking for a quieter base rather than a busy tourist district. You can expect a more local, residential atmosphere with less nightlife and more low-key evenings. It is a good fit if you prefer relaxed surroundings and easy access by car.
